What kind of neighbourhood is Yeronga where 7 Ormonde Road is located?
Yeronga is a southern riverside suburb of Brisbane with a 2021 population of 7,062 people. It is bounded by the Brisbane River on the west and north, offering parkland and open spaces near the river.
Is the area around 7 Ormonde Road prone to flooding?
Parts of Yeronga experienced significant flooding in the 1974 and 2011 Brisbane River floods, especially low‑lying properties near the river. The suburb’s higher ridgelines, such as Kadumba Street, remained accessible during those events.
What public transport options are available near 7 Ormonde Road?
Yeronga railway station on the Beenleigh line is a short walk away, providing frequent services to the Brisbane CBD and beyond. Several bus routes (including routes 107, 127 and 192) also run through the suburb, linking to the city, the University of Queensland and Indooroopilly.
